The Keenes Crossing Elementary zone sits in the Windermere area west of Orlando, where suburban neighborhoods share space with lakes and the growing Horizon West corridor. Families are drawn here for the schools, with feeder options like Windermere High and Horizon West Middle shaping where buyers look. Disney's parks are about 24 minutes away, and downtown Orlando is a 26-minute drive, so weekday commutes and weekend outings both stay manageable.
Right now there are 27 active listings among the broader Windermere homes for sale, with a median list price of $682,000 and a range from $375,000 to $934,999. Homes are taking a median of 57 days to sell, and over the last year 106 sales closed at a median of $600,000 — with sellers collecting about 97% of asking. Keenes Crossing Elementary FAQs
Is the Keenes Crossing Elementary zone a good place to live?+
It's a popular family choice in the Windermere area, valued for its schools and its location west of Orlando. Feeder schools include Windermere High and both Horizon West and Bridgewater Middle, and Disney's parks are about 24 minutes away. The mix of neighborhoods and short drives to work and play keeps demand steady.
Is it expensive to buy here?+
The median list price is $682,000, with active homes ranging from $375,000 up to $934,999. At an average of $250 per square foot on a median home size of 2,665 square feet, pricing reflects the family-sized homes that define the zone. Notably, there are currently no listings above $1 million among the 27 active properties.
What do homes cost in this zone?+
Over the past 12 months, 106 homes sold at a median price of $600,000, while today's active listings carry a higher median list of $682,000. That gap, plus sellers averaging about 97% of asking, suggests buyers can often negotiate below list. You can compare current options on the live map.
How is the market right now?+
With 27 active listings and a median 57 days on market, there's inventory to work with and pace isn't frantic. Sellers are getting roughly 97% of asking on average, so well-priced homes still move while buyers keep some room to negotiate.
What about HOA fees and property taxes?+
The median HOA runs about $188 per month, in line with the managed communities common in the Windermere area. Median annual property tax is around $8,479, and if you're weighing renting first, the median rent sits near $3,099 per month.
